The Effect of Feed Steam on MED Dealing with High-salinity Wastewater

The treatment of high salinity wastewater treatment in refinery has been widely noticed due to more and more stringent laws and regulations. In the paper, in order to deal with the high salinity wastewater efficiently, a MED process was performed, and mathematical modeling was established to discuss the effect of feed steam on MED dealing with high-salinity wastewater. The results indicated that the temperature of steam produced by different low-temperature heat and pressures of the steam could all affect the MED system obviously. For example, the mass of pure water increased slightly with the increase of feed steam temperature in 3 effects system. With the same pressure feed steam, more mass of pure water was produced by fewer effects system, etc. This paper would provide a very useful reference for the high-salinity wastewater reduction via MED process in petroleum refinery.
